IWMSPlaylist.FireEvent (C#)
The FireEvent method sends the specified event to the broadcast publishing point's shared playlist object.
Playlist.FireEvent(
string pbstrEventName
);
Arguments
pbstrEventName |
[in] string containing the event name. |
Return Value
This method does not return a value.
Remarks
In order to achieve a faster stream switch, the IWMSPlaylist.CueStream method should be called prior to the FireEvent method. Send the specified event to the playlist. The event being trapped must be associated with a media element that is a child element of an excl time container.
Example
using Microsoft.WindowsMediaServices.Interop;
using System.Runtime.InteropServices;
// Declare variables.
WMSServer Server;
IWMSPlayers Players;
IWMSPlayer Player;
IWMSPlaylist Playlist;
string strEvent;
try {
// Create a new WMSServer object.
Server = new WMSServerClass();
// Retrieve the IWMSPlayers object.
Players = Server.Players;
// Retrieve information about each client connection.
for (int i = 0; i < Players.Count; i++)
{
Player = Players[i];
// Retrieve the playlist requested
// by the client, if one exists.
Playlist = Player.RequestedPlaylist;
// Send the event for the requested playlist.
strEvent = "excl1_Event";
Playlist.FireEvent (strEvent);
}
}
catch (COMException comExc) {
// TODO: Handle COM exceptions.
}
catch (Exception e) {
// TODO: Handle exceptions.
}
Requirements
Reference: Add a reference to Microsoft.WindowsMediaServices
Namespace: Microsoft.WindowsMediaServices.Interop
Assembly: Microsoft.WindowsMediaServices.dll
Library: WMSServerTypeLib.dll
Platform: Windows Server 2003 family, Windows Server 2008 family.
